Idaho State University is a popular option for students interested in an associate degree in engineering technologies. ISU is a fairly large public university located in the city of Pocatello. This isn't the only ranking where the school placed. It's also #2 in quality for associate degrees in engineering technologies in Idaho.

There were approximately 63 engineering technologies individuals who graduated with this degree at ISU in the most recent data year.

Every student pursuing a degree in an associate degree in engineering technologies has to look into College of Western Idaho. Located in the rural area of Nampa, CWI is a public college with a large student population. You also may be intersted to know that the school ranks #3 in quality for associate degrees in engineering technologies in Idaho.

There were about 38 engineering technologies students who graduated with this degree at CWI in the most recent data year.
